Introduction of Semenggoh Orangutan Centre



The Semenggoh Orangutan Centre, developed in 1964, works as a crucial haven for the rehabilitation and conservation of orangutans in Malaysia. Found approximately 24 kilometers from Kuching, the center spans over 740 hectares of all-natural rain forest, giving a helpful setting for the orangutans to thrive. It largely concentrates on restoring rescued orangutans, much of whom have actually been displaced as a result of logging and unlawful animal trade.


The center runs under the auspices of the Sarawak Forestry Firm and is devoted to enlightening the public about the significance of orangutan conservation. Site visitors to Semenggoh can observe these splendid creatures in their natural environment throughout feeding times, while overviews supply understandings right into the orangutans' habits and conservation initiatives. The facility likewise plays a vital role in research and monitoring of wild orangutan populations, adding to recurring preservation initiatives.


Additionally, the Semenggoh Orangutan Centre highlights sustainable practices, functioning carefully with regional neighborhoods to advertise awareness and involvement in preservation efforts. This complex technique guarantees the lasting survival of orangutans and their habitat, making the center a cornerstone of wild animals conservation in Malaysia.

Finest Times to See Orangutans

To optimize your chances of coming across orangutans in their natural habitat, intending your see around particular times of the day and year is crucial. The ideal time to observe these stunning animals at the Semenggoh Orangutan Centre is throughout the daily feeding sessions, his explanation which normally occur at 9:00 AM and 3:00 PM. These arranged feedings bring in orangutans from the bordering forest, supplying site visitors with an unique chance to witness them up close.


In regards to seasonal considerations, the dry season, which usually extends from March to October, is perfect for identifying orangutans. Throughout this period, the weather is normally extra beneficial, with much less rains, permitting much better visibility and access within the reserve. Alternatively, the wet period, from November to February, can lead to muddy routes and enhanced vegetation, making it extra challenging to find the orangutans.


Eventually, checking out throughout the very early morning or late mid-day can yield the most effective results, as orangutans are much more active throughout these cooler components of the day. By straightening your go to with these optimal times, you improve your possibilities of experiencing the amazing globe of orangutans at Semenggoh.


Just How to Get There



Getting To the Semenggoh Orangutan Centre is a straightforward journey for wildlife lovers eager to observe these amazing primates. The centre lies roughly 24 kilometers from Kuching city, making it easily accessible via various settings of transport.

For those opting to drive, the path is well-signposted. Head southeast on Jalan Tun Abang Haji Openg, after that take the useful site turning onto Jalan Semenggoh, which leads directly to the centre. The trip commonly takes about 30 minutes, relying on traffic conditions.


Mass transit is additionally a practical choice. Normal buses run from Kuching to Semenggoh, and site visitors can capture them from the city's primary bus terminal. Ride-hailing solutions like Grab are convenient and offer a door-to-door experience.
